fix(sync): guard against mass DELETED_IN_ROA when ROA is recovering
After a power loss + reboot, COMENZI was queryable but not yet recovered; phase 4b-3 read it as empty and sticky-marked 3794 live orders DELETED_IN_ROA (nulling id_comanda). check_orders_exist also swallowed Oracle errors and returned a partial set, which callers misread as deletions. - check_orders_exist now re-raises on Oracle error instead of returning partial - new invoice_service.deletions_or_guard() raises MassDeletionGuard when the would-delete fraction is implausibly high (>30% of >=25 imported orders) - both deletion sites (auto sync + manual refresh) skip + log on guard trip Co-Authored-By: Claude Opus 4.8 (1M context) <noreply@anthropic.com>
